    I personally relate to Beomseok a lot and that's sad but that's how one of the first things I noticed with the whole confronting his bullies scene is that Sooho and Sieun never turn to violence to "protect" him. Like they already know the amount of abuse he endured at the hands of these people and even after they witness the insincerity and bile that apology held, they choose to not let their emotions dictate them. It's not a bad thing but with how twisted Bumseok's world and morals are, this was the last straw and it could also be seen as a betrayal because we have seen both of these characters use extreme violence while they dealt with their own matters. Examples that Bumseok witnessed are -- Sieun's response to being drugged; Sooho protecting himself when he was targetted by those seniors; and lastly the situation that started their friendship, Sooho and Bumseok saving Sieun from thugs. These were all situation where Sooho and Sieun used violence to protect themselves but somehow that "protection" did not extend to Bumseok and to helping him out with his situation. Telling Sooho and Sieun everything about the bullies left Bumseok feeling vulnerable but he at least felt like he could trust them. He must've felt safe with his friends being there while they confronted the bullies. And in that moment of safety he let go and allowed himself to express his anger which he otherwise would've been too afraid to do or would not have done at all. We see his disdain to turn towards violence when the show starts and we've seen how he slowly becomes used to it, and Sooho and Sieun definitely play a part there. So when Sooho tried to stop him and calm him down, that must've made him feel small again in front of the bullies. He was vulnerable, ashamed and he already felt pathetic so to see Sooho and Sieun's reaction (that could be viewed as condescending) -- when finally it was his turn to make amends using the very tool he has seen all these other people around him use -- must've been devastating and made him think of them as hypocrites. Anyway these are my two cents and how I interpreted Bumseok's character arc.

    I really love your in-depth analysis of his character!! Beom Seok is indeed complex and realistic. At the beginning of the show, he's already portrayed as a character with an unstable background, as he was not only abused at home but also bullied at school. This moulds him into a character who is constantly cautious and often rethinks his actions, as he is afraid of the outcomes they may create. However, it becomes evident as the scene goes on that he develops a more violent and aggressive personality.
    His character shows us the effects of abuse in different ways, and viewers overlook that because they think he did it solely because Sooho did not follow him on Instagram. However, if we pay more attention to him in the show, there are many instances where he is triggered, which leads him to be an abuser near the end of the show. He doesn't feel like he has anyone on his side, and even though he spends time with Si Eun and Sooho, he believes that he is inferior to them and feels left out in the group.
    He was also triggered when Young Yi joined his friend group, since he thought she stole his place because they paid less attention to him. It is clear that he was seeking validation-the attention that he never received from his family. Nevertheless, he seeks the most validation from Sooho, that being said, because he is the strongest in the friend group. Apart from that, his inferiority complex made the situation worse. Sooho was everything Beom Seok wanted to be; he wa confident, strong, outspoken and looked up to. On the other hand, Beom Seok was weak, insecure and hated himself. We can see the difference in his emotions towards Sooho, from looking up to him to gradually resenting him because he could never have those qualities.
    Additionally, Sooho insulting him triggers his emotions, which makes him hate Sooho even more. This foreshadows their fallout due to the lack of communication between those three. However, simplifying the solution that he should've told them how he felt is not as easy as that. The reason why Beom Seok is having a difficult time expressing himself is because of the way he grew up. It's devastating to see how Beom Seok was both the one who started the friendship and the one who ended it.
    Overall, I'm really amazed by how detailed and well-made his character is. He portrays trauma so realistically, both in terms of thoughts and emotions. Though I can see why some people hate him, he truly deserved so much better.
